Output 74efea8882b28d11596cf19faece01145e8d73016444e4ff06d221f288613e88:0

value
522000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 580fc410d8101fb829920dc2ba6e059a2c818e5df7988df53ab28853dd4f336a
address
bc1ptq8ugyxczq0ms2vjphpt5ms9ngkgrrja77vgmaf6k2y98h20xd4q38lv9d
transaction
74efea8882b28d11596cf19faece01145e8d73016444e4ff06d221f288613e88
confirmations
60921
spent
true